Source: Associated Press

HOUSTON — A grand jury declined to indict a suburban Houston homeowner for shooting to death two men he believed were burglarizing his neighbor's house.

Joe Horn, 61, shot the two men in the back last November after he saw them leaving a neighbor's house in Pasadena, a Houston suburb.

Horn confronted the men with a 12-gauge shotgun after a 911 dispatcher pleaded with him not to go outside his house.

On a 911 tape of the call, Horn can be heard threatening the two men, who were both shot in the back.

Joe Horn no billed by grand jury

 http://abclocal.go.com/ktrk/story?section=news/local&id...

HOUSTON -- A suburban Houston homeowner was cleared by a grand jury Monday for shooting to death two men he suspected of burglarizing his neighbor's home.

Joe Horn, 61, shot the two men last November after he saw them crawling out the windows of a neighbor's house in Pasadena, a Houston suburb.

Horn, a retired grandfather, called 911 and told the dispatcher he had a shotgun and was going to kill them. The dispatcher pleaded with him not to go outside, but Horn confronted the men with a 12-gauge shotgun and shot both in the back.

"The message we're trying to send today is the criminal justice system works," Harris County District Attorney Kenneth Magidson told reporters at the courthouse.

eta: I wish I could have been a fly on wall of the grand jury room. Texas law is perhaps the most permissive of all the states when it come to use of force. Horn's initial position was that it was self-defense, but Texas also has laws where (under some specific circumstances) one can use force to stop a fleeing felon even when it involves a third party.
